Budget enough to upgrade road sections: Dr Khatiwada

Kathmandu / June 15: Minister for Finance Dr Yuba Raj Khatiwada has said there was adequate budget allocated for upgrading Ramche-Mulkharka road section.

At an interaction with local body representatives here today, Minister Khatiwada clarified that the government had enough budget to upgrade various road sections including this road section in the country as these road sections linked to the Nepal-China border points and their upgrade would ease the process to import the goods from the northern border.

He also urged the locals to support the government in developmental agendas. The participants have urged the Minister to ease the process to construct Dhunche-Gosainkunda cable car service including other infrastructure development in the district. RSS
